Hi ladies,

I am also looking for an outdoor venue for my ROM . Its difficult coz i only got 30pax yet want privacy. here's what i conclude so far:

Altivo: Good only for nite events. Place looks a little run-down in day-light. Night-view very nice. Day-price: $1300. Includes food & table settings. Nite: still waiting for price. Coordinator follow-up not very good.

Botanic Gardens:
Burkhill Hall (lovely but expensive. $3000 for rental only). Also better at night coz no wandering tourists then. Coordinator Siow Hong is very good.

Can also consider Halia & Les Amis Au Jardin.

Fort Canning: There're many different areas for different party sizes. I've got some pixs that the coordinator sent. Can email those interested. Go www.nparks.gov.sg to check the rental rates for various venues. only thing is,got to do everything yourself. Hotel packages are more convenient.

Raffles Hotel: Expensive, esp. for small gps.

Beaufort Sentosa: Nice, but far. the only difference is got sea.

Some other suggestions i got off this forum:

Alkaff - nice view, food not so good.

Flamingo Lounge at Jurong Bird Park - check website. there's a "Tree-top" concept for small gps of 40pax.

Hayatt has a function room with garden concept.

Four Seasons Hotel has a roof-top terrace.

Hi Geri,

They are charging me $1,500.00++ for the villa for a night stay and $80.00++ per pax for the buffet for 30 people. It is expensive, but I can't find any other places that can provide me privacy as well as accomodation for my overseas guests.

Unless, I book the hotel rooms, but too troublesomes for them lah. Both of us are going for a private function style and hopefully this is the best we are looking at.

hi greenleaf &amp; postpet

more details on equinox.
happy.gif
went there this afternoon to see the place, etc. the staff there are super friedly! we will be taking the $40 menu for high tea for 30pax. the function room is great with a marvelous view! there will be signs at the introbar (indicating ur ROM on the 69th floor) and signs + urshers on the 69th floor to lead ur guests to the function room. reception table can be arranged if you need it. ( i didnt ask for it so i dont know if there are extra costs) they are very nice and flexi people and i'm sure they'll make our ROM a good one.
